Nigeria Labour Congress (NLC) Kaduna State Council has resolved to withdraw services in kaduna state as a solidarity with over four thousand workers sacked by the state government.
Chairperson of the state Council, Comrade Ayuba Magaji Suleiman and the Secretary Comrade Christiana John Bawa stated this in a statement made available to media in kaduna yesterday.
The statement stated that activities in the state will be grounded for five days as proposed by the National Headquarters to serve as warning strike for sacking the workers
According to the statement, the decision was resolved in an emergency meeting held with the delegation from the national headquarters of congress in Kaduna.
It said that the total withdrawal of services would commences this coming Sunday 16th May, 2021 by 12:00am (midnight).
